Ryan Gosling Would Star In A Batman Movie If It Had This Director


Ryan Gosling might not be part of the DC Extended Universe yet, but with Ben Affleck's future in the franchise remaining fairly uncertain, it looks like the Blade Runner 2049 star is hoping to star in a Batman film – well if it were directed by La La Land star Damien Chazelle.

Sitting down to speak in an interview with Variety to help promote the upcoming biographical drama movie First Man, Gosling was asked whether he'd like to play Batman someday. Though the Canadian actor and musician essentially laughed the publication off, the Lars and the Real Girl star admitted that he might think about suiting up as the Dark Knight if Chazelle would direct the film.

Directing both La La Land and First Man, Chazelle has developed a great working relationship with Gosling who would only enter the superhero game if the director were to helm a superhero film. Of course, while it's definitely interesting to imagine what Goslin would be like as Gotham's Capped Crusader, Chazelle is currently busy working on other projects including First Man and The Eddy. Besides, Warner Brothers already has Matt Reeves and The Batman.

The Batman doesn't have a release date yet but we'll keep everyone updated as soon as we get word.
